Rapeseed oil is a vegetable oil extracted by crushing rapeseed, traded internationally as a bulk agricultural commodity for refining, food-oil production and biodiesel feedstock. It is one of the most widely traded vegetable oils, with commercial value driven by free fatty acid content, moisture and impurities, and color grade. Bulk rapeseed oil is traded as a commodity feedstock for refining into food-grade oil and for further processing into biodiesel and oleochemical products.
Typical applications include:
- Refining into food-grade vegetable oil
- Biodiesel (FAME) production
- Renewable diesel (HVO) feedstock
- Oleochemical and industrial lubricant manufacturing
- Blending with other vegetable oil feedstocks
- Re-export and terminal storage trading
Its favorable fatty acid profile and consistent commodity specification make it a versatile feedstock for both food and fuel value chains.
| Parameter | Unit | Typical Range |
|---|---|---|
| Free fatty acid (FFA) content | % | 0.5 – 2.0 |
| Moisture and impurities (M&I) | % | ≤ 0.5 |
| Color (Lovibond, 5.25″ cell) | Red units | ≤ 3.0 |
| Iodine value | g I₂/100g | 110 – 115 |
| Density at 15°C | kg/m³ | 910 – 920 |
| Unsaponifiable matter | % | ≤ 1.5 |
| Peroxide value | meq O₂/kg | ≤ 10 |
Specifications vary depending on crushing origin and production batch, and are contracted according to FOSFA quality terms.
| Parameter | Description |
|---|---|
| Delivery terms | FOB / CFR / CIF, contracted under FOSFA standard contract terms |
| Transport modes | Tanker vessel (parcel or full cargo), ISO tank containers, flexitanks, road tanker |
| Shipment size | 1,000 – 20,000 MT per parcel; smaller volumes via flexitank or ISO tank |
| Packaging | Bulk liquid; flexitanks or ISO tank containers for smaller lots |
| Storage | Ambient bulk storage tanks, port terminal tank farms |
| Handling | Pumping systems, tank-to-tank transfer, tank cleaning and inspection prior to loading |
